A galaxy moves with respect to the earth, so that sodium line of \(589.0 \mathrm{~nm}\) is observed at \(589.6 \mathrm{~nm}\). The speed of the galaxy is

  1. A \(300 \mathrm{kms}^{-1}\)
  2. B \(306 \mathrm{kms}^{-1}\)
  3. C \(400 \mathrm{kms}^{-1}\)
  4. D \(406 \mathrm{kms}^{-1}\)
